Okay, for those who like to edumacate, rather than insulate...

You can't have a 'header' for a 3rd gen. A header goes on a naturally aspirated car. Like a Honda Civic, that you can buy a header for. Or any NA RX-7, like a 1st or 2nd gen. On a turbocharged car, such as the 3rd generation RX-7, it's simply called a turbo manifold. And there isn't an aftermarket high flow manifold for the stock twins, really. You'd have to go full single conversion to get an aftermarket manifold, which is $$$^2
